OFFICIAL VISIT OF RUSSIAN PRESIDENT TO ARMENIA TO TAKE PLACE IN AUTUMN

PanARMENIAN.Net - YEREVAN, February 17. /Mediamax/. The President of the Russian Federation Vladimir Putin will pay an official visit to Armenia in October-November 2001, an informed source told Mediamax.

The President of Russia is also to visit Yerevan in May 2001 to take part in the conference of the Council of member-states of the CIS Collective Security Agreement.

In 2001 the presidents of Belarus, Georgia, Kazakhstan, Lebanon and Poland will also visit Armenia. --0--
